  • Title

    Text-dependent speaker recognition using the information in the higher frequency band

  • Abstract
    In previous studies, the speaker individual information in the higher frequency band has been almost neglected. Therefore, we investigate the speaker characteristics in the higher frequency band and the effects of using them for speaker recognition. This paper presents the results of speaker identification experiments performed in a text-dependent mode using various frequency bands. Moreover, we propose a new distance measure combining the lower and the higher frequency bands. The experiment results show effectiveness of using the individual information in the higher frequency band to improve the speaker recognition performance
